matlab仿真实例100题:MATLAB仿真实例精选100例,从入门到精通的实践指南


MATLAB仿真的重要性
MATLAB仿真广泛应用于信号处理、控制系统、图像处理、通信系统、金融建模等领域,通过仿真,工程师和研究人员可以在计算机环境中模拟真实系统的运行,节省时间和成本,提高设计效率,对于初学者而言,通过仿真实例学习MATLAB,能够快速理解其语法结构、函数调用和工具箱的使用方法。
MATLAB仿真实例100题的分类与内容
以下将仿真实例分为基础、进阶和专业三大类,涵盖MATLAB的核心功能:
基础类(20题)
- 矩阵运算:矩阵加减、乘法、逆矩阵、行列式计算等。
- 基础绘图:二维曲线绘制、三维曲面绘制、散点图、柱状图等。
- 数据导入导出:从Excel、CSV文件中读取数据,并进行可视化分析。
- 循环与条件语句:使用for、while循环和if-else语句实现复杂逻辑。
进阶类(50题)
- 信号处理:傅里叶变换、滤波器设计、信号频谱分析。
- 控制系统:传递函数建模、PID控制器设计、系统稳定性分析。
- 图像处理:图像滤波、边缘检测、图像增强。
- 数值积分与微分:使用trapz、integral等函数进行数值积分。
- 优化问题:线性规划、非线性优化、遗传算法应用。
专业类(30题)
- 通信系统仿真:调制解调、信道编码、误码率分析。
- 机器学习入门:神经网络训练、支持向量机分类。
- 金融建模:期权定价、风险价值(VaR)计算。
- 机器人学仿真:运动学正反解、路径规划。
- 有限元分析基础:结构力学仿真、热传导方程求解。
如何高效利用仿真实例进行学习
- 循序渐进:从基础题开始,逐步过渡到进阶和专业题目,避免一开始就挑战复杂问题。
- 理论结合实践:在学习MATLAB语法的同时,通过仿真实例加深理解。
- 代码复现与修改:先复现已有案例,再尝试修改参数或扩展功能,培养独立解决问题的能力。
- 利用MATLAB官方文档:遇到问题时,查阅官方文档或帮助文件,是提升效率的重要途径。
- 加入学习社群:与其他MATLAB用户交流,分享经验和代码,解决疑难问题。
“MATLAB仿真实例100题”不仅是一份练习题集,更是一条通往精通MATLAB的实践之路,通过系统学习和反复练习,读者将能够熟练掌握MATLAB的核心功能,胜任各类工程计算与仿真任务,无论是学生、教师还是科研人员,这份仿真实例都能为你的学习和研究提供强有力的支持。

文章已关闭评论!










